Subject: [PATCH 0/6] Apple device properties

Apple EFI drivers supply device properties which are needed to support
Macs optimally.
This series extends the efistub to retrieve the device properties before
ExitBootServices is called (patch [1/6]). They are assigned to devices
in an fs_initcall (patch [5/6]). As a first use case, the Thunderbolt
driver is amended to take advantage of the Device ROM supplied by EFI
(patch [6/6]).
A by-product is a parser for EFI Device Paths which finds the struct
device corresponding to a given path. This is needed to assign
properties to their devices (patch [3/6]).

It would be good if one of the resident EFI experts could look over
patch [1/6] to see if I've made any mistakes that might prevent this
from working on 32 bit. It was only tested on 64 bit, I don't know
anyone with an older Mac who could test this.
Specifically, is the following okay:
efi_early->call((unsigned long)sys_table->boottime->locate_protocol, ...)
It would be convenient to have LocateProtocol or LocateHandleBuffer in
struct efi_config so that they can be called with efi_call_early().
Would a patch to add those be entertained? Right now we only offer
LocateHandle and HandleProtocol, which is somewhat cumbersome and
needs more code as the setup_pci() functions show.
